Output 312d6ef60edbcd1eb9ea2dcb558e20a41e1075806cc101d6c88ad9f1e4144571:0

value
75000000
script pubkey
OP_0 OP_PUSHBYTES_20 d6b7a9807ebc1207df630ac13a5d26e9f003c15a
address
ltc1q66m6nqr7hsfq0hmrptqn5hfxa8cq8s262c08uq
transaction
312d6ef60edbcd1eb9ea2dcb558e20a41e1075806cc101d6c88ad9f1e4144571
spent
true